Comparison of arthroscopic primary and revision Bankart repair for capsulolabral restoration: a matched-pair analysis.

Hyung-Min LeeJoon-Ryul LimWon-Woo LeeSung-Jae KimTae-Hwan YoonYong Min Chun
Published in: Archives of orthopaedic and trauma surgery (2022)
The height and slope of the repaired capsulolabral structures in the early postoperative period after arthroscopic revision Bankart repair group were significantly lower than those of the primary Bankart repair group. Also the reduction of labral height and slope was significant in the revision Bankart repair group over time. Nonetheless, clinical outcomes did not differ significantly except return to premorbid sports activity level at final follow-up.
